County Commissioner Dunbar, State Sen. Lang happy about Keystone XL news

Last Friday, President Donald Trump announced that his administration had approved the Keystone XL pipeline which starts in Alberta, Canada - and runs through five Montana counties including about 24 miles into the northeast corner of Phillips County - and ends in Steele City, Neb.

"TransCanada will finally be able to complete this long overdue project with efficiency and speed," President Trump said during a Friday press conference.
